This beautiful Castle with its yellow stone walls reflecting the sunlight was started in the 13th Century and has been in the current owner’s family for three generations. Very private yet just a short walk to shops and restaurants, this wonderful castle offers a stately home in the sunny South of France and presents many great opportunities.
There are numerous outbuildings to be converted if desired and a pretty garden comprising of rambling shady areas under ancient trees.
This place oozes charm and history while offering all modern comforts and vast opportunities to make this property a B&B, small hotel, gîtes or an expansive family home.
Description of the buildings
The Castle offers 400m² living area on 2 levels
Ground floor (basement):
Various cellars measuring 220m² in total.
1st floor: Access to the main house is via a magnificent external stone staircase opening onto a terrace leading into the 26m² hall way with its original stone arched doorway and staircase dating back to the 15th Century. Sitting room 27.5m² with turret of 4m², small sitting room of 10m², bedroom 24m², all opening out onto the south facing terrace, kitchen 20m², office 11m², utility room 10m², WC, dining room 36.5m², library 25m², bedroom 13.5m and second bedroom (or possible en-suite bathroom) 13.5m². Terraces totaling 70m² facing south and west.
2nd floor: large landing of 22.5², bathroom 9.5m², hallway 11.5m², WC, 5 bedrooms 24.5m², 26.5m² with 4m² turret, 21m² with ensuite bathroom of 5m², 15.5m² and 15.5m² respectively, bathrooms of 8m² and 9.5m², two attic areas that could be converted totaling 96m².
Outbuildings
There are three garages totaling 88m² with another 88m² on the first floor above, two small stables 17m², ancient ovens and a kennel.
Grounds
The castle is in a dominating position set in a lovely walled park of 6200m².
General condition
The whole property is in excellent condition with the potential to develop further. Most of the original features have been preserved adding to the overall charm of this wonderful property. Single glazed wooden windows and doors with oil fired central heating and reversible air conditioning. Also original fireplaces.
